By the way, I've been to a number of home-venue gaming sessions when I was still in Califonia & a few times in Manila.
It might be a good idea to inform the guests of any "house rules" just to make sure we don't get on the bad side of the spouse especially.

From my experience, here are some pointers that might help:

> B mindful not to make a mess in their bathroom (whethr they have a maid or not is beside the point, trust me)
> Don't ask too much food from the host, bring ur own if u haven't had dinner yet
> If u want, u can bring a little something for the hosts (e.g. bottle of soda, cookies, ice cream, or anything that u can afford)
> Help clean up after & don't forget to thank the hosts.

Like I said, thats just from my experince so u can just take it as a grain of salt
